However, the integration of such devices into urban life is not without challenges. Safety concerns have been raised due to incidents involving falls and collisions. Furthermore, regulations regarding their use on sidewalks and roads vary by municipality, adding a layer of complexity for potential riders. Manufacturers and local governments are working together to address these issues through improved design, rider education, and clearer guidelines.
